
When Shure agreed to send me a early release version of their new Shure E4g Gaming Edition Earphones last month I was stoked. At an MSRP of $319 USD I expected to be blown away, and I was, just not in a good way.
It has been a long time since I was so thoroughly disappointed in a product I reviewed. The Shure E4g Gaming Edition Earphones did not sound as good as my $140 set of Steel Sound headphones I typically use for my late night gaming sorties.
This was my first review of a Shure product, and I hear good things about Shure from audiophiles, but man the Shure E4g Gaming Edition Earphones just underperformed.
I think to "Become the Game" you need to have some bass, perhaps that is a personal preference. The Shure E4g Gaming Edition Earphones bass reproduction was to my ears very weak, weak with a capitol "W".
Flatulance from my one-year old daughter has more bass than these things, well maybe not but you get the idea. The highs and mids were good, but low end sounds like gun shots were flat and had no depth at all.
Through the entire range of sounds I could hear an irritating static hiss similar to what you would hear if you had an old vinyl album on a turn table playing one of the grooves between tracks.
I tested the Shure E4g Gaming Edition Earphones via the headphone port on my Klipsch Pro Media Ultra 5.1 speakers powered by my PCs Creative X-Fi Xtreme Music sound card, which is the same set up I use for all my earphone and headphone tests.
If you need the small stature of the Shure E4g Gaming Edition Earphones for your portable device rather than a home PC, I suggest you buy one of the lower end Shure gaming edition earphone sets. After all, they can't be worse, can they?
Had I plunked down my hard earned $319 bucks for the Shure E4g Gaming Edition Earphones, I would be taking Shure up on their 30 day money-back guarantee.
